There are no technical difficulties; in fact, there is a 4-wheel drive dirt road almost all the way to the top, as there are dozens of antennas near the summit. I hiked almost 2000m vertical in under 8 hours from the National Park entrance, but was passed by a few ATV. Visibility was fairly good, but unfortunately low clouds were obscuring the view to both Atlantic and Pacific. <\/p>\n<p>The climb is described in the Blog post &#8216;<a href=\"http:\/\/tlausser.com\/blog\/2009\/12\/panama-and-volcan-baru\/\">Panama and Volcan Baru<\/a>&#8216;.<\/p>\n","protected":false},"excerpt":{"rendered":"<p>Elevation: 3475 m (11401 ft) Location: Panama, Chiriqu? province, 8? 48&#8242; N; 82? 33&#8242; W Distinction: Highest mountain in Panama; one of only a few summits from where you can see both the Atlantic and Pacific Ocean.
